Output f689e317af98c2556155bfe5ce996dcfdcd6498e8ec033e1da667f96019d4755:1

value
18492708
script pubkey
OP_0 OP_PUSHBYTES_20 c2f1aaec6e32cfd13c14d6a49880783d9615556c
address
ltc1qctc64mrwxt8az0q566jf3qrc8ktp24tvtdm3e6
transaction
f689e317af98c2556155bfe5ce996dcfdcd6498e8ec033e1da667f96019d4755
spent
true